Definitions for: Oversupply [n] the quality of being so overabundant that prices fall
[v] supply with an excess of; "flood the market with tennis shoes"; "Glut the country with cheap imports from the Orient"
Webster (1913) Definition: O`ver*sup*ply", v. t.
To supply in excess.
O"ver*sup*ply`, n.
An excessive supply.
A general oversupply or excess of all commodities. --J.
S. Mill.
Synonyms: flood, glut, glut, surfeit
See Also: furnish, overabundance, overmuch, overmuchness, provide, render, superabundance, supply
